[Detailed Description of the Invention] (Industrial Application Field) The present invention relates to an improvement of a caster with a brake that can actuate the brake and stop the rotation of the wheels by depressing the pedal.

(Prior art) In conventional casters with brakes, an elastic brake plate is attached to the leg that supports the wheel along the side of the wheel, and a pedal is mounted on the outside of this elastic brake plate coaxially with the wheel so that it can freely rotate back and forth. It is known that the elastic brake plate is pressed inward and flexed by rotating the pedal back and forth, so that it comes into contact with the side of the wheel and then separates it.

(Problems to be solved by the invention) In the above conventional caster with brake,
Since the elastic brake plate that is pressed against the wheel is made of metal, there is a problem that sufficient frictional force with the wheel cannot be obtained, causing the wheel to slide.

(Function) In the caster with a brake of the present invention, when the pedal 5 is depressed and one end thereof is rotated in the upward direction, this presses the bulging portion 4a of the elastic plate 4 inward and slides on the outer surface thereof. Then, it overlaps with the bulged portion 4a, and the outer surface of one end comes into contact with the inner surface of the leg 2 and stops. In this state, one end of the pedal 5 is connected to the outer side of the leg 2.
Since it is suppressed by , it receives a large reaction force. During this time, one end of the elastic plate 4 is pressed by one end of the pedal 5 and deflects inward, and the brake pad 6 is pressed against the side surface of the wheel 3, thereby fixing the wheel 3. The brake pads 6 are made of elastic resin and have a large frictional force with the wheels 3, so that a large braking force can be obtained. At the same time as the pedal 5 overlaps the bulging portion 4a, the engaging portion 5a at the other end of the pedal 5 engages with the corresponding engaging portion 4b of the elastic plate 4 and is held in that state. Therefore, even if the wheel 3 is subjected to vibration and the brake pad 6 is repeatedly slightly compressed and restored, there is no fear that the pedal 5 will shift or move.
To release the brake, the pedal 5 may be depressed in the opposite direction and rotated in the opposite direction.

Next, the operation of this embodiment will be explained. The caster of this embodiment is normally used while traveling in the state shown in FIGS. 2 and 3. When the footplate 5c of the pedal 5 is depressed from this state, the pedal 5 rotates counterclockwise in FIG. 2, and the stopper 5f comes into contact with the edge of the leg 2, resulting in the state shown in FIGS. Stop at. During this time, the sliding slope 5e of the pedal 5 rides on the bulge 4a of the elastic plate 4, slides while pressing it inward, and stops with its upper outer edge in contact with the inner surface 2a of the leg 2. do. Therefore, the elastic plate 4 is the pressing piece 5
d and deflects inward, and the brake pad 6 is pressed against the side surface of the wheel 3, preventing its rotation. The pressing piece 5d cooperates with the inner surface 2a of the leg 2 to press and hold the brake piece 4c of the elastic plate 4 inward. Further, in this state, the engaging part 5a of the pedal 5 is fitted into the engaging part 4b of the elastic plate 4, and the brake is held so that it will not easily come off due to external force such as vibration. If you press down on the treadle 5b of the pedal 5, the second
The state returns to the state shown in Figure 3 and the brake is released.
